WebOct 24, 2024 · Nutter Butters should not be given to dogs as a treat due to the high sugar and fat content. Though they do not contain any ingredients that are actually toxic to dogs, they can cause stomach upset, vomiting, and diarrhea. Since they are made with wheat flour, dogs that are sensitive to wheat or gluten may have a particularly bad reaction. For … WebIn short, peanuts and peanut butter are perfectly safe for dogs. In fact, almost all nut butters are safe. Dogs cannot have macadamia nuts, but almond butter and hazelnut butter are perfectly fine. The problem occurs when other ingredients are added to the nuts, such as chocolate (no Nutella!) or xylitol.
